Daily Use English to Hindi Sentences
| English | Hindi |
|---|---|
| I wake up at six in the morning. | मैं सुबह छह बजे उठता हूँ। |
| What are you doing right now? | तुम अभी क्या कर रहे हो? |
| I will call you in the evening. | मैं तुम्हें शाम को फ़ोन करूँगा। |
| It is very hot today. | आज बहुत गर्मी है। |
| I am getting late for work. | मुझे काम के लिए देर हो रही है। |
| Please switch off the light. | कृपया बत्ती बंद कर दीजिए। |
| I forgot my phone at home. | मैं अपना फ़ोन घर पर भूल गया। |
| Let me think about it. | मुझे इसके बारे में सोचने दो। |
Greetings and Introductions
| English | Hindi |
|---|---|
| Hello, how are you? | नमस्ते, आप कैसे हैं? |
| My name is Rahul and I am from Delhi. | मेरा नाम राहुल है और मैं दिल्ली से हूँ। |
| It is nice to meet you. | आपसे मिलकर खुशी हुई। |
| What do you do for a living? | आप क्या काम करते हैं? |
| I have heard a lot about you. | मैंने आपके बारे में बहुत सुना है। |
| How is your family? | आपका परिवार कैसा है? |
| See you tomorrow. | कल मिलते हैं। |
| Take care of yourself. | अपना ख़याल रखना। |
Family and Home
| English | Hindi |
|---|---|
| My mother is cooking dinner. | मेरी माँ रात का खाना बना रही हैं। |
| My brother is younger than me. | मेरा भाई मुझसे छोटा है। |
| We live in a joint family. | हम संयुक्त परिवार में रहते हैं। |
| The guests are coming on Sunday. | मेहमान रविवार को आ रहे हैं। |
| Please clean your room. | कृपया अपना कमरा साफ़ करो। |
| Dinner is ready, come to the table. | खाना तैयार है, मेज़ पर आ जाओ। |
| My grandfather tells us stories every night. | मेरे दादाजी हमें हर रात कहानियाँ सुनाते हैं। |
| Where are the house keys? | घर की चाबियाँ कहाँ हैं? |
School and Office
| English | Hindi |
|---|---|
| I have an important meeting today. | आज मेरी एक ज़रूरी बैठक है। |
| Please send me the report by email. | कृपया मुझे रिपोर्ट ईमेल से भेज दीजिए। |
| The exam starts at ten in the morning. | परीक्षा सुबह दस बजे शुरू होती है। |
| I could not finish my homework. | मैं अपना गृहकार्य पूरा नहीं कर सका। |
| May I take leave tomorrow? | क्या मैं कल छुट्टी ले सकता हूँ? |
| The teacher is explaining the lesson. | अध्यापक पाठ समझा रहे हैं। |
| I will complete this work by Friday. | मैं यह काम शुक्रवार तक पूरा कर दूँगा। |
| Please speak a little louder. | कृपया थोड़ा ज़ोर से बोलिए। |
Market and Shopping
| English | Hindi |
|---|---|
| How much does this cost? | यह कितने का है? |
| The price is too high, please reduce it. | दाम बहुत ज़्यादा है, कृपया कम कीजिए। |
| Do you have this in a bigger size? | क्या आपके पास यह बड़े साइज़ में है? |
| I want to buy two kilos of rice. | मुझे दो किलो चावल खरीदने हैं। |
| Can I pay by card? | क्या मैं कार्ड से भुगतान कर सकता हूँ? |
| Please give me the bill. | कृपया मुझे बिल दे दीजिए। |
| These vegetables are fresh. | ये सब्ज़ियाँ ताज़ी हैं। |
| I will come back later. | मैं बाद में वापस आऊँगा। |
Travel and Directions
| English | Hindi |
|---|---|
| Where is the railway station? | रेलवे स्टेशन कहाँ है? |
| How far is the airport from here? | हवाई अड्डा यहाँ से कितनी दूर है? |
| Turn left at the next signal. | अगले सिग्नल पर बाएँ मुड़िए। |
| The train is running two hours late. | ट्रेन दो घंटे देरी से चल रही है। |
| Please stop the car here. | कृपया गाड़ी यहाँ रोक दीजिए। |
| I have lost my way. | मैं रास्ता भटक गया हूँ। |
| Which bus goes to the market? | बाज़ार कौन सी बस जाती है? |
| Book a ticket for tomorrow morning. | कल सुबह के लिए एक टिकट बुक कर दीजिए। |
Food and Restaurant
| English | Hindi |
|---|---|
| The food is very tasty. | खाना बहुत स्वादिष्ट है। |
| I am vegetarian. | मैं शाकाहारी हूँ। |
| Please make it less spicy. | कृपया इसे कम मसालेदार बनाइए। |
| Can I see the menu, please? | क्या मैं मेन्यू देख सकता हूँ? |
| I would like a cup of tea. | मुझे एक कप चाय चाहिए। |
| We are four people. | हम चार लोग हैं। |
| Is this dish very spicy? | क्या यह व्यंजन बहुत तीखा है? |
| Please bring some more water. | कृपया थोड़ा और पानी लाइए। |
Health and Emergency
| English | Hindi |
|---|---|
| I am not feeling well. | मेरी तबीयत ठीक नहीं है। |
| I have a headache since morning. | मुझे सुबह से सिरदर्द है। |
| Please call a doctor. | कृपया डॉक्टर को बुलाइए। |
| Where is the nearest hospital? | सबसे नज़दीकी अस्पताल कहाँ है? |
| Take this medicine twice a day. | यह दवा दिन में दो बार लीजिए। |
| I am feeling much better now. | अब मैं काफ़ी बेहतर महसूस कर रहा हूँ। |
| Call the ambulance immediately. | तुरंत एम्बुलेंस बुलाओ। |
| Do you have a fever? | क्या तुम्हें बुखार है? |
WhatsApp and Chat Sentences
| English | Hindi |
|---|---|
| Good morning, have a great day! | सुप्रभात, आपका दिन शुभ हो! |
| I will reach in ten minutes. | मैं दस मिनट में पहुँच जाऊँगा। |
| Sorry, I saw your message late. | माफ़ करना, मैंने तुम्हारा संदेश देर से देखा। |
| Call me when you are free. | जब खाली हो तो मुझे फ़ोन करना। |
| Happy birthday! May all your wishes come true. | जन्मदिन मुबारक! आपकी सारी इच्छाएँ पूरी हों। |
| Congratulations on your new job! | नई नौकरी की बधाई हो! |
| Let me know once you reach home. | घर पहुँचकर बता देना। |
| I am busy right now, I will call you later. | मैं अभी व्यस्त हूँ, बाद में फ़ोन करूँगा। |
Common Questions in Hindi
| English | Hindi |
|---|---|
| What is your name? | आपका नाम क्या है? |
| Where do you live? | आप कहाँ रहते हैं? |
| What time is it? | कितने बजे हैं? |
| Why are you so late? | तुम इतनी देर से क्यों आए? |
| Can you help me with this? | क्या आप इसमें मेरी मदद कर सकते हैं? |
| Do you speak English? | क्या आप अंग्रेज़ी बोलते हैं? |
| When will you come back? | तुम वापस कब आओगे? |
| How was your day? | तुम्हारा दिन कैसा रहा? |

What is the sentence structure difference between English and Hindi?
English follows Subject-Verb-Object order ("I eat mangoes") while Hindi follows Subject-Object-Verb order ("Main aam khata hoon" - literally "I mangoes eat"). The verb almost always comes at the end of a Hindi sentence.
Are these Hindi sentences formal or informal?
The tables use a mix. Sentences with "aap" (आप) are respectful and safe in any situation. Sentences with "tum" (तुम) are informal, used with friends, family, and people younger than you.
